    What Collaros did in those 4 games was pure magic. But they were extraordinary circumstances, where you can almost pin it down to divine intervention as to how everything worked out with the storylines, luck and the bought-in motivated performance of every single player on the team. To think he would play that way all of next season is a bit wishful, IMO. He would have bad games, and is susceptible to injury. 
    Say what you want about Nichols, but he’s given us 4 straight winning seasons since he has arrived. And he did win a difficult semi-final in Regina last year. He deserves a go at it on his terms, to try and win the whole damn thing with himself at the helm. With Buck as (potentially) our OC, and a bit of a chip on his shoulder watching another QB win the cup on his team, Nichols could be a whole different monster next year. I would not write him off just yet.
